Output ee04539a03ca105219d307d333cbc1568e3811f5f987e56cdf135e79fdac62d4:2

value
72052050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363eb2ab30c27405d8640fdaa8197ff60e387b11 OP_EQUAL
address
MCqyq7kYFyJJgJvwoKXEAbWYWTUiX4ELnF
transaction
ee04539a03ca105219d307d333cbc1568e3811f5f987e56cdf135e79fdac62d4
spent
true